Abstract

This article explored the dynamic and innovative approaches to worship among Pentecostal churches in Nigeria. Using qualitative analytical approach as well as participant observation, this paper revealed the role of worship innovation among Pentecostal churches in attracting and retaining members which foster spiritual growth, and promoting community engagement. It equally found out that the Pentecostals in Nigeria are redefining traditional worship practices, while incorporating contemporary elements such as music, technology and social media to create vibrant and engaging worship experiences. The paper furthered argued that some of these creativities, especially in the area of healing and deliverance are unbiblical, unnecessary and raises moral questions. The paper ended by positing that worship must be bible based; for worship is prescribed in the Bible.
